Transaction 3c43033a7ae78f409bb10a2227c18b58b45c1f8b915146f94e22ff36ced9f11e

1 Input
2 Outputs
  • 3c43033a7ae78f409bb10a2227c18b58b45c1f8b915146f94e22ff36ced9f11e:0
  • value  2004882
    address  1HBLBHXNZARjVpB9Mk2RuicUfqy6JXVtv9
  • 3c43033a7ae78f409bb10a2227c18b58b45c1f8b915146f94e22ff36ced9f11e:1
  • value  5214467
    address  1KZhSwZoqhh6WuaByYsNCyhA1hmNgTyYua